- Meghan Stacey is Senior Lecturer in the Sociology of Education and Education Policy at the UNSW School of Education, where she takes a particular interest in the critical policy sociology of teachers' work. Her first book, The Business of Teaching, was published in 2020 with Palgrave. Nicole Mockler is Professor of Education at the Sydney School of Education and Social Work at the University of Sydney. Her research focuses on education policy and politics, particularly as they frame teachers' work, professional identities, and professional learning. Her most recent book is Constructing Teacher Identities (Bloomsbury, 2022).
